Software Engineering Manager

 

Are you a seasoned Software Engineering Manager looking for an exciting new role? An unparalleled opportunity awaits you within a rapidly growing Electronic Money Institution.

 

With a global footprint spanning Australia, Cyprus, Lithuania, UK, Netherlands, USA, Israel, and Malta, our client is at the forefront of providing cutting-edge financial solutions.

 

 

The Role

In this role you will manage, estimate, plan and schedule software delivery throughout the release lifecycle whilst coordinating our various product lines. You will facilitate the process required to move software releases into production while coordinating with different teams to ensure the smooth delivery of software releases with zero or near zero customer disruption

 

Location:

Nicosia, Cyprus.

 

This role will operate onsite 5 days a week. Due to the nature of this role, remote working and hybrid options are unavailable. 

 

What will your job look like?

 

Your goal is to provide the tools, skills, and services needed to help product teams manage and deploy code into production and you will be expected to deliver on-time and high-quality releases.

 

Manage the “floor” and ensure that the development teams are delivering quality product, on time.

 

Responsibilities:

  • Manage a centralized release plan and process across product lines.
  • Assist in building the work breakdown structure, with gap analysis, and ensuring that specifications and priorities are clear.
  • Identify and mitigate risks and issues regarding release quality and schedule.
  • Estimate, schedule, and coordinate releases and release dependencies across multiple products, teams and projects. This includes quality assurance and other operational activities required to deliver a working service.
  • Develop the estimation, scheduling and planning skills of team leads.
  • Tactical schedule decision making to maximize throughput while keeping overall priorities in mind.
  • Continuously monitor projects and provide reports about their progress.
  • Manage releases through a multi-tier environment and monitor the health & availability, and effectiveness of the non-production tiers.
  • Ensure team leads are following planning and engineering policies and procedures.
  • Monitoring the release process and collecting feedback from the development team and quality assurance.
  • Making improvements on a regular basis to the release process.

What you need is..

  • Experience managing team leads working on multiple projects, with an indirect team size of more than 20.
  • A background in Java and/or C#, preferably gained in development of banking, payments, telecommunications or secure communications systems.
  • Engineering, Computer Science or a related field background with advanced knowledge of the software development lifecycle.
  • Familiarity with automated release management for hosted applications.
  • Thorough knowledge of options for incremental and controlled release: API/endpoint versioning, feature flags, A/B testing, customer level configuration, blue/green deployment, rollback plans, canaries, etc.
  • Experience with Jira (preferred), MS Project or other project management tools.
  • Experience with Jenkins, Bitbucket (or other git), and their use in the release process.
  • Experience with Agile practices, and particularly Kanban.
  • Proven experience with reducing inefficiencies by creating consistent automated processes which result in high-quality releases.
  • Ability to solve any issues that arise – strong interpersonal skills and problem-solving abilities to resolve any cross-functional team issues
  • Proven experience of working under pressure.
